The Life-Changing Symptoms of Severe B12 Deficiency

Vitamin B12 deficiency manifests through a complex array of symptoms that can profoundly disrupt daily life. The most common early signs include persistent fatigue that doesn't improve with rest, making even simple tasks feel overwhelming. This exhaustion often progresses to more serious symptoms as the deficiency worsens.

Cognitive symptoms frequently develop, including memory problems, difficulty concentrating, and mental fog that can significantly impact work performance and personal relationships. Many individuals report feeling like they're "losing their mind" as they struggle with tasks that were once routine.

Physical manifestations include tingling or numbness in hands and feet, balance problems, and muscle weakness. These neurological symptoms can severely limit mobility and independence, forcing lifestyle changes that further impact quality of life.

Long-Term Neurological Damage from Untreated Deficiency

When vitamin B12 deficiency remains untreated, the consequences extend far beyond temporary discomfort. The nervous system requires adequate B12 levels to maintain the protective myelin sheath around nerve fibers. Without sufficient B12, this protective coating deteriorates, leading to potentially irreversible nerve damage.

Peripheral neuropathy represents one of the most serious long-term complications, causing permanent numbness, pain, and weakness in extremities. Some individuals experience difficulty walking or performing fine motor tasks, requiring assistive devices or mobility aids that fundamentally alter their independence.

Cognitive impairment can also become permanent when deficiency persists. Memory problems may evolve into dementia-like symptoms, and some individuals never fully recover their previous mental acuity even after treatment begins. The earlier the intervention, the better the chances of preventing irreversible damage.

Spinal Cord Complications

Subacute combined degeneration of the spinal cord represents the most severe neurological consequence of B12 deficiency. This condition affects both sensory and motor pathways, potentially causing permanent disability if not addressed promptly. Early recognition and aggressive treatment are essential to prevent lasting impairment.

Why B12 Deficiency Goes Undiagnosed

Medical professionals often overlook vitamin B12 deficiency because its symptoms mimic numerous other conditions. The gradual onset of symptoms means patients and doctors may attribute fatigue and cognitive issues to stress, aging, or other health problems rather than considering nutritional deficiency.

Standard blood tests don't always reveal B12 deficiency accurately. Serum B12 levels can appear normal while cellular deficiency exists, leading to false reassurance. More sensitive tests like methylmalonic acid (MMA) or homocysteine levels are often necessary but aren't routinely ordered.

The medical system's focus on treating symptoms rather than investigating underlying nutritional causes contributes to delayed diagnosis. Patients may receive treatments for depression, fibromyalgia, or other conditions without addressing the root B12 deficiency that's causing their symptoms.

Age and Risk Factor Bias

Healthcare providers sometimes assume B12 deficiency only affects older adults or vegetarians, missing cases in younger individuals or those with adequate dietary intake who have absorption problems. This bias can delay proper testing and treatment for years.

Effective Treatment Strategies for Recovery

Recovery from severe vitamin B12 deficiency requires aggressive treatment that goes beyond simple dietary changes. Injectable B12 therapy typically provides the most effective initial treatment, bypassing absorption issues that may have contributed to the deficiency.

High-dose oral or sublingual B12 supplements can be effective for maintenance therapy once initial levels are restored. However, individuals with absorption problems may require ongoing injections to prevent recurrence of deficiency symptoms.

Treatment response varies significantly between individuals. Some people experience dramatic improvement within days of starting therapy, while others may require weeks or months to notice substantial changes. Neurological symptoms typically take longer to resolve than other manifestations.

Comprehensive Recovery Approach

Successful recovery often requires addressing underlying causes of deficiency, whether related to dietary factors, medications, or medical conditions affecting absorption. Working with healthcare providers to identify and correct these root causes prevents future recurrence and ensures sustained recovery.

Prevention and Long-Term Management

Preventing vitamin B12 deficiency from disrupting daily functioning requires understanding personal risk factors and implementing appropriate preventive measures. Regular monitoring through blood tests allows early detection before symptoms develop.

Dietary strategies include consuming adequate amounts of B12-rich foods such as meat, fish, eggs, and fortified products. However, individuals with absorption issues may require supplementation regardless of dietary intake.

Those at higher risk, including older adults, vegetarians, individuals with gastrointestinal conditions, or those taking certain medications, should work with healthcare providers to develop personalized prevention plans that may include regular supplementation or monitoring.

Lifestyle Modifications

Supporting overall nutritional health through balanced eating, stress management, and addressing underlying health conditions creates a foundation for maintaining adequate B12 levels. Regular follow-up care ensures that any changes in health status or risk factors are addressed promptly.

How can untreated vitamin B12 deficiency cause long-term neurological damage or disability?

Untreated B12 deficiency damages the protective myelin sheath around nerves, leading to peripheral neuropathy with permanent numbness and weakness in extremities. It can also cause subacute combined degeneration of the spinal cord, resulting in severe mobility issues and potential paralysis. Cognitive impairment may become irreversible, resembling dementia symptoms that don't improve even with treatment.

Why is vitamin B12 deficiency often misdiagnosed or overlooked by doctors?

B12 deficiency symptoms mimic many other conditions like depression, fibromyalgia, or chronic fatigue syndrome. Standard blood tests may show normal B12 levels while cellular deficiency exists, requiring more specialized testing. Many doctors don't consider nutritional deficiencies in younger patients or those with seemingly adequate diets, leading to delayed diagnosis and treatment.

What are the most effective treatments to recover from severe vitamin B12 deficiency symptoms?

Injectable B12 therapy provides the most effective initial treatment, typically given daily or weekly for several weeks, then monthly for maintenance. High-dose oral or sublingual supplements can work for some individuals once levels are restored. Treatment duration varies, with some symptoms improving within days while neurological symptoms may take months to resolve.
